scripts = new Dictionary();
int counter = -1;
foreach (string filePath in filesPaths) {
scripts[filePath] = true;
EditorUtility.DisplayProgressBar("Add Namespace", filePath, counter / (float) filesPaths.Count);
counter++;
string contents = File.ReadAllText(filePath);
string result = "";
bool havsNS = contents.Contains("namespace ");
string t = havsNS ? "" : "\t";
using(TextReader reader = new StringReader(contents))
{
int index = 0;
bool addedNS = false;
while (reader.Peek() != -1)
{
string line = reader.ReadLine();
if(line.IndexOf("using")>-1 || line.Contains("#")){
result += line+"\n";
}else if(!addedNS && !ha